What is FIDEA Holdings's market cap?
FIDEA Holdings (8713) has a market capitalization of approximately ¥37.8B, trading at ¥2095.00 on the JPX. Market cap moves with the live share price.
What is FIDEA Holdings's P/E ratio?
FIDEA Holdings's trailing twelve-month P/E ratio is 9.2x, with a price-to-book (P/B) of 0.4x. Valuation multiples are best compared with Financial Services sector peers rather than read in isolation.
How profitable is FIDEA Holdings?
FIDEA Holdings runs a net profit margin of 8.0%, a gross margin of 90.3%, and an operating margin of 8.6%. Margins and ROE indicate how efficiently the business converts sales into profit and shareholder returns.
How much revenue does FIDEA Holdings generate?
FIDEA Holdings reported revenue of ¥51.8B for fiscal year 2025, with net income of ¥4.1B and earnings per share (EPS) of 228.74. SniperIQ tracks the full 8-quarter revenue and margin trend on the research dashboard.
Does FIDEA Holdings pay a dividend?
FIDEA Holdings offers a trailing dividend yield of about 3.6%. Dividend sustainability depends on payout ratio, free cash flow, and earnings stability — all tracked in SniperIQ's fundamentals view.
Is FIDEA Holdings financially healthy?
FIDEA Holdings carries a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.21x and a current ratio of 0.00x, with a market beta of 0.28. Lower leverage and a current ratio above 1.0 generally signal a stronger balance sheet.
